....water in the State of Gujarat. As the appellant was not paying any service tax on the said service, investigations were conducted at their end. It was revealed that the contract for laying long distance pipe lines for transfer of water in the State of Gujarat was awarded to them by M/s. Gujarat Water Supply and Sewerage Board (herein after referred as GWSSB), an independent body constituted under the Gujarat Act No. 18 of 1979, which is called as Gujarat Water Supply and Sewerage Board Act, 1978. As the Revenue entertained a view that services being provided by the appellant to M/s. GWSSB are covered by the category of "Commercial or Industrial Construction Service", they carried on further investigation to find out the status of GWSSB. Statement of various persons were recorded during the course of investigations and on the basis of which proceedings were initiated against the appellant by way of issuance of show cause notice dated 10,10.2007 for the period June 2005 to March 2007 for recovery of service tax under the category of Commercial or Industrial Construction Services. .... both the sides, we find that there is no dispute about the legal position that the category of service of "Commercial or Industrial Construction" creates liability to pay service tax on the construction activities if the pipelines or conduits are used or to be used primarily for Commerce or Industry. The Board circular No. 116/10/2009-ST dated 15.09.2009 has clarified that canals constructed by the Government or under Government projects are not liable to service tax under Commercial or Industrial Construction service. For better appreciation, we reproduce Para 2 of the said circular :- "2. Thus the essence of the definition is that the "Commercial or Industrial construction service" is chargeable to service tax if it is used, occupied or engaged either wholly or primarily for the furtherance of commerce or industry. As the canal system built by the Government or under Government projects, is not falling under commercial activity, the canal system built by the Government will not be chargeable to service tax. However, if the canal system is built by private agencies and is developed as a revenue generating measure, then such construction should be charged to service tax." In....

The perusal of the above duties and functions of the Board clearly show that sale of water is not the primary function of the Board. It is also clear that the water purchased by the Board is being distributed to rural and urban areas for the purpose of irrigation and drinking at different rates which are subsidized and even the operating cost also does not stand recovered by them. To setup an establishment for water supply is a part of the duties and functions of the State to provide its citizens with a better living.
